IXC404I
SYSTEM(S) ACTIVE OR IPLING: system-names

Explanation

This system attempted to initialize the sysplex, but XCF found that there are one or more systems that appear to be active (in that they are defined to the sysplex, as represented in the sysplex couple data set), but one or more of these systems do not appear to actually be active because the time of their last system status update is not recent.

XCF requires operator assistance to understand whether these systems are only residual information in the sysplex couple data set, or are in fact active systems in the sysplex despite their out-of-date system status update times. Note that this message displays all of the active and IPLing systems in the sysplex, not just the systems that are in this in-doubt state.

This message is issued only when one or more systems, other than this system, appear to be active in the sysplex. Thus, this message is not issued when the only system that appears to be active in the sysplex is the one that is being IPLed. A determination of whether another system is the same as the system being IPLed can be made only in native MVS™ and PR/SM™ systems. For two systems to be the same, they must have identical central processor information so that if this is the first IPL of the system on a new processor, XCF does not find a match. In PR/SM systems, all of the information, including the LPAR ID, must be the same.

In the message text:
system-names
A table of system names.

System action

The system issues message IXC405D, prompting the operator to indicate whether this system should join the already initialized sysplex (if the operator decides that these systems are truly active in the sysplex), or start initializing a new sysplex instance (if the operator decides that these systems are residual and not active).

Operator response

See the operator response for message IXC405D.

System programmer response

Check all the displayed systems to determine if they are active and if this system belongs in a sysplex with them.
